A cut above the rest: Cork salon offers helping hand to the homeless

Having a haircut is often an emotional experience for a long-time homeless person. When life is about surviving the elements, having your hair washed and styled can have a benefit to your spirit which far outweighs how you look in the salon mirror.

Cork salon owner Joseph Byrne, who recently spent a day cutting hair for the homeless, says he has seen people get visibly upset during the cutting process. Many times they are living a life devoid of touch.
